Search Engine Marketing

Agile development

Agile development is an approach used by web developers working on a large and complex project. As it's impossible to know all of the aspects of a technical design at the beginning, the development is approached in stages, enabling the project to evolve as both the client and web developers understand more about the project scope and complexity. Agile development reduces the redundancy that a standard linear approach to a large project creates (i.e. long specification design process, then development and testing).